Taejongdae provides a myriad of paths along the Coastline to explore in addition the famed Yeongdo Lighthouse and sculpture. The most effective (and most entertaining) way to get all over Taejongdae with kids is to go ahead and take brightly coloured Danubi Coach, which departs every single 20 minutes or so.
The Gamcheon Cultural Village is becoming an icon of Busan and no excursion to town is total devoid of visiting the neighborhood turned art task. It?�s a novel community revitalization venture through which they took an impoverished Group and turned its narrow alleyways and streets into an art gallery.
They've got numerous features for children (like playgrounds) plus are close to public transportation and equally have public toilets.
Dadaepo Beach front is found with the junction in the Nakdonggang River as well as the South Sea, a a single hour bus trip south west from Busan Station. Dadaepo Beach front has shallow sheltered h2o which is a superb option for people, paddleboarding, kiteboarding and collecting clams and crabs at minimal tide.

Haeundae Beach is easily the most famed position in the town of Busan. This sandy beach, sometimes overcrowded in summer months, is one of South Korea?�s most popular swimming places. For the foot of quite tall buildings, inside of a lively district filled with cafes and restaurants, Haeundae is a pleasing spot to rest when experiencing the sea.
